# Limits and Quotas: Shelfwright Catalogue Import

The Shelfwright importer accepts MARC and CSV batches from partner libraries and stages them through the Hollis validation queue. To protect the catalogue database, imports are subject to per-tenant quotas: batch size, records per hour, and concurrent staging jobs. Exceeding a quota queues the batch rather than rejecting it, but staged batches expire after 48 hours. Raising a quota requires sign-off from the data team. The enforced limits are defined by the constants below.

tuning table, yajog-yahof:
BUDGETS = {
    "lamvan": 303,
    "wenox": 460,
    "fenvan": 525,
}

## Changelog — Ticktrace 1.9

### Renamed: DRIFT_API_TOKEN
During the cron drift investigation we found plugins confusing this variable with the metrics token, so it has been renamed to indicate it authorizes drift-report uploads specifically. Plugin authors must read the new name from 1.9 onward; the old name is ignored without warning. Sample env files in the SDK are updated. In your deployment env file, the drift-report upload secret is set on the next line.

env line for fawef-taguf: VAULT_KEY13=a9695905a9a90

TURN-208: Gatevale turnstile counters at the Merrow Field pilot double-count when a rotation reverses mid-cycle. Attendance totals drift roughly 2% high per event. The debounce window fix is implemented, reviewed by Ilsa, and soak-tested across two simulated match days without drift. Ready for your cut; the candidate build is identified below.

trace token, tagag-tafog: htk6_5ed18c

Previously, a dropped connection triggered immediate reconnects with no backoff, flooding the Amberline broker and occasionally duplicating subscription frames. The patched client now applies exponential backoff with jitter, caps attempts at eight, and resends the subscription manifest only after a confirmed handshake. Reviewers should verify the backoff timer resets solely on a successful frame. Test reconnects against the staging broker using the internal key below.

gateway credential: kto23_LX9A4ys6i4nzHtpOLNLodKK